Abstract

This chapter considers synchronization problems for a homogeneous multi-agent system (MAS) when the input for each agent is subject to saturation and unknown input delay. In earlier chapters we have addressed delays in Chap. 6 (continuous-time) and in Chap. 7 (discrete-time). We have also studied MAS with saturation in Chap. 4. The objective of this chapter is to combine these results to the case where we have both delays and saturation.
